105 changes: 105 additions & 0 deletions Tests/modules/io_related/test_mmap.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,105 @@
# Licensed to the .NET Foundation under one or more agreements.
# The .NET Foundation licenses this file to you under the Apache 2.0 License.
# See the LICENSE file in the project root for more information.

'''
Tests the _mmap standard module.
'''

import sys
import os
import errno
import mmap

from iptest import IronPythonTestCase, is_cli, is_posix, is_windows, run_test

class MmapTest(IronPythonTestCase):

def setUp(self):
super(MmapTest, self).setUp()

self.temp_file = os.path.join(self.temporary_dir, "temp_mmap_%d.dat" % os.getpid())

def tearDown(self):
self.delete_files(self.temp_file)
return super().tearDown()


def test_constants(self):
self.assertTrue(hasattr(mmap, "PAGESIZE"))
self.assertTrue(hasattr(mmap, "ALLOCATIONGRANULARITY"))

self.assertEqual(mmap.ACCESS_READ, 1)
self.assertEqual(mmap.ACCESS_WRITE, 2)
self.assertEqual(mmap.ACCESS_COPY, 3)
if sys.version_info >= (3, 7) or is_cli:
self.assertEqual(mmap.ACCESS_DEFAULT, 0)
self.assertFalse(hasattr(mmap, "ACCESS_NONE"))

if is_posix:
self.assertEqual(mmap.MAP_SHARED, 1)
self.assertEqual(mmap.MAP_PRIVATE, 2)
self.assertEqual(mmap.PROT_READ, 1)
self.assertEqual(mmap.PROT_WRITE, 2)
self.assertEqual(mmap.PROT_EXEC, 4)


def test_resize_errors(self):
with open(self.temp_file, "wb+") as f:
f.write(b"x" * mmap.ALLOCATIONGRANULARITY * 2)

with open(self.temp_file, "rb+") as f:
m = mmap.mmap(f.fileno(), 0, offset=0)
with self.assertRaises(OSError) as cm:
m.resize(0)

self.assertEqual(cm.exception.errno, errno.EINVAL) # 22
if is_windows:
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.winerror, 1006) # ERROR_FILE_INVALID
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.strerror, "The volume for a file has been externally altered so that the opened file is no longer valid")
else:
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.strerror, "Invalid argument")

self.assertTrue(m.closed)


def test_resize_errors_negative(self):
with open(self.temp_file, "wb+") as f:
f.write(b"x" * mmap.ALLOCATIONGRANULARITY * 2)

with open(self.temp_file, "rb+") as f:
m = mmap.mmap(f.fileno(), 0, offset=0)
if is_cli or sys.version_info >= (3, 5):
self.assertRaises(ValueError, m.resize, -1)
self.assertFalse(m.closed)
else:
self.assertRaises(OSError, m.resize, -1)
self.assertTrue(m.closed)

m.close()


def test_resize_errors_offset(self):
with open(self.temp_file, "wb+") as f:
f.write(b"x" * mmap.ALLOCATIONGRANULARITY * 2)

with open(self.temp_file, "rb+") as f:
m = mmap.mmap(f.fileno(), 0, offset=mmap.ALLOCATIONGRANULARITY)

if is_windows:
with self.assertRaises(PermissionError) as cm:
m.resize(0)
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.errno, errno.EACCES) # 13
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.winerror, 5) # ERROR_ACCESS_DENIED
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.strerror, "Access is denied")
else:
with self.assertRaises(OSError) as cm:
m.resize(0)
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.errno, errno.EINVAL) # 22
self.assertEqual(cm.exception.strerror, "Invalid argument")

self.assertTrue(m.closed)


run_test(__name__)
